In shakeup atop one of the largest live-production-technology-services providers in the U.S., Mobile TV Group founder and CEO Philip Garvin in transitioning into the role of Chairman of the Board, while his son Nick Garvin, former COO, will take over the role of CEO. Nick moves into the CEO role after more than 11 years at MTVG, working in various roles while developing into a trusted industry voice and respected leader.
Mobile TV Group founder Philip Garvin (center) is shifting into the role of Chairman of the board after leading the company as its CEO for the past three decades.
For Philip, 2024 marks 50 years in broadcasting. After starting as an author, photographer, producer, and director, Philip launched Colorado Studios in 1974, and then in 1994, launched what became Mobile TV Group. In 2001, Philip launched HDNet/AXS.TV with Mark Cuban.
At MTVG, Philip Garvin played a pivotal role in leading the company through significant growth and innovation, while also shaping the live production technology landscape as a whole. His appointment to Chairman preserves his valued leadership and expertise with the company while empowering CEO Nick Garvin to run the overall operations and direction.

Nick Garvin takes over as CEO on MTVG
Nick Garvin's tenure as COO includes the development and implementation of Cloud Control, MTVG's flagship remote production solution, 1080P HDR, MTVG Edge, and navigating, negotiating and managing invaluable client relationships.
Outside of MTVG, Nick Garvin founded Stackup, an educational technology startup using AI to deliver metrics on students' digital reading and learning progress to hundreds of schools across the United States. Stackup's patented system was named Denver Post's Tech Startup of the Year in 2016 and was acquired in 2021. Nick was a part of the 2018 Forbes 30 Under 30 class, as well as Denver Business Journal's and L.A. TV Week's 40 Under 40 classes in 2023.
These promotions come at a pivotal time in live sports production, as the regional sports landscape and production workflows are experiencing seismic shifts, which Nick Garvin is navigating for MTVG.

Using decentralized and remote units, the company delivers trusted, flexible and fully integrated broadcast services for major sports leagues and events. Mobile TV Group has offered high quality broadcast engineering for nearly 30 years. The company introduced Cloud Control, the first fully remote production managed service, in response to the evolving industry. Mobile TV Group produces more than 4,000 major live events each year, covering professional and collegiate sports, live music, entertainment, eSports and business events.
